What Makes a Great College Football Fan Base?
Before we jump into the rankings, let's define what makes a truly great college football fan base. It's more than just showing up to games (although that's definitely a big part of it!). Several factors contribute to an exceptional fan experience and unwavering support:
- Attendance: Consistently filling the stadium, even for non-conference games, is a key indicator of a dedicated fan base.
- Atmosphere: Creating a loud, intimidating, and energetic environment that gives the home team a distinct advantage.
- Tradition: Embracing and celebrating the unique traditions and rituals that make their college football program special. From tailgating to fight songs, these traditions create a sense of community and shared identity.
- Travel: Following the team on the road, showing up in force at away games and bowl games.
- Passion: An unwavering love for the team, win or lose. This means sticking by the team during tough seasons and celebrating the victories with unbridled enthusiasm.
- Community: A strong sense of community among fans, creating a welcoming and inclusive environment for everyone who supports the team. This can involve tailgating together, participating in fan clubs, and supporting the team through charitable initiatives.
- Knowledge: A deep understanding of the game and the team's history, showing a true appreciation for the sport.
- Dedication: How much are fans willing to invest their time, money, and energy into supporting the team? This could involve attending games, buying merchandise, donating to the athletic program, and following the team closely.
When you put all these factors together, you start to get a picture of what a truly great college football fan base looks like. It's a group of people who are passionate, dedicated, and knowledgeable, and who create an unforgettable atmosphere for both players and fellow fans.

1. Texas A&M Aggies
No list of top college football fan bases would be complete without the Texas A&M Aggies. The 12th Man tradition is legendary, with students standing throughout the entire game to show their unwavering support. Kyle Field is one of the loudest and most intimidating stadiums in the country, and the Aggie faithful travel well, creating a sea of maroon wherever they go. The dedication of the 12th Man is unmatched, making them a perennial contender for the title of best fan base in college football. The passion for Texas A&M football is deeply ingrained in the culture of the university and the surrounding community. From the moment students arrive on campus, they are immersed in the traditions and rituals of Aggie football. The 12th Man tradition is more than just standing during the game; it's a symbol of unity, loyalty, and unwavering support for the team. This tradition has been passed down through generations of Aggies, creating a strong sense of community and shared identity. Kyle Field is not just a stadium; it's a sacred place where Aggie fans come together to celebrate their love for the team. The atmosphere is electric, with the roar of the crowd creating a constant wall of sound that can be deafening for opposing teams. The Aggie faithful are known for their creative cheers, their elaborate tailgates, and their unwavering belief in their team. Win or lose, the Aggies always show up in force to support their team, making them one of the most respected and feared fan bases in college football. The Aggie Network, a vast alumni association, further amplifies the support for the team, ensuring that the spirit of Aggieland extends far beyond the campus borders. The combination of tradition, passion, and unwavering support makes the Texas A&M Aggies a force to be reckoned with, both on and off the field.
2. LSU Tigers
Death Valley in Baton Rouge is a place where opposing teams' dreams go to die. The LSU Tigers have one of the most passionate and intimidating fan bases in the country. The tailgating scene is legendary, and the fans create an atmosphere that's second to none. From the moment you step onto the LSU campus on game day, you can feel the electricity in the air. The aroma of Cajun cuisine fills the air, and the sounds of live music and cheering fans create a festive atmosphere that's hard to resist. The tailgating scene at LSU is a true spectacle, with fans setting up elaborate spreads and grilling everything from alligator to jambalaya. The passion for LSU football is contagious, and even visiting fans can't help but get caught up in the excitement. Once inside Death Valley, the atmosphere becomes even more intense. The stadium is known for its deafening roar, and the fans create a sea of purple and gold that can be intimidating for opposing teams. The LSU faithful are known for their unwavering support, and they never give up on their team, no matter the score. Win or lose, the LSU Tigers can always count on their fans to be there, cheering them on until the very end. The combination of tradition, passion, and unwavering support makes LSU one of the toughest places to play in college football.
3. Alabama Crimson Tide
The Alabama Crimson Tide have a long and storied history, and their fans are among the most dedicated in the nation. Bryant-Denny Stadium is a sea of crimson on game day, and the fans are known for their knowledge of the game and their unwavering support. The tradition of Alabama football is deeply ingrained in the culture of the state, and generations of fans have grown up cheering for the Crimson Tide. From the Bear Bryant era to the Nick Saban dynasty, Alabama has consistently been one of the top programs in college football, and their fans have been there every step of the way. Bryant-Denny Stadium is more than just a stadium; it's a symbol of the pride and tradition of Alabama football. The atmosphere on game day is electric, with fans decked out in crimson from head to toe. The roar of the crowd can be deafening, and the fans are known for their creative cheers and their unwavering support. The Alabama faithful are among the most knowledgeable in the country, and they understand the game at a deep level. They appreciate the hard work and dedication of the players, and they never take a winning season for granted. Win or lose, the Alabama Crimson Tide can always count on their fans to be there, cheering them on with passion and pride. The combination of tradition, knowledge, and unwavering support makes Alabama one of the most respected and feared programs in college football.
4. Ohio State Buckeyes
The Ohio State Buckeyes have a massive and passionate fan base that stretches across the state of Ohio and beyond. The Shoe is one of the largest stadiums in the country, and it's always packed with Buckeye fans who are ready to cheer on their team. The Ohio State University is a massive institution, and its football program is a source of pride for the entire state. The Buckeyes have a long and storied history, and their fans are among the most loyal and dedicated in the nation. The Shoe, officially known as Ohio Stadium, is one of the largest and most iconic stadiums in college football. On game day, it transforms into a sea of scarlet and gray, with over 100,000 fans packed inside, cheering on their team. The atmosphere is electric, with the roar of the crowd creating a constant wall of sound. The Buckeye faithful are known for their creative cheers, their elaborate tailgates, and their unwavering belief in their team. Win or lose, the Ohio State Buckeyes can always count on their fans to be there, supporting them with passion and pride. The combination of tradition, size, and unwavering support makes Ohio State one of the most formidable programs in college football.
5. Penn State Nittany Lions
The Penn State Nittany Lions have a unique and dedicated fan base that's known for its unwavering support and its iconic White Out game. Beaver Stadium is one of the largest stadiums in the world, and the White Out is one of the most visually stunning and intimidating traditions in college football. The entire stadium dresses in white, creating a sea of unity and support for the Nittany Lions. The atmosphere is electric, and the noise level can be deafening, making it a truly unforgettable experience for both players and fans. The Penn State faithful are known for their loyalty and their resilience, and they have stood by their team through thick and thin. The combination of tradition, passion, and unwavering support makes Penn State one of the most respected and admired programs in college football.
Honorable Mentions
Of course, there are many other college football fan bases that deserve recognition. Here are a few honorable mentions:
- Oregon Ducks: Known for their innovative uniforms and their passionate fans who create a unique atmosphere at Autzen Stadium.
- Clemson Tigers: The Clemson faithful are known for their unwavering support and their unique traditions, such as running down the hill before each game.
- Wisconsin Badgers: The Badger fans are known for their tailgating traditions, their love of cheese, and their enthusiastic rendition of "Jump Around" between the third and fourth quarters.
- Notre Dame Fighting Irish: The Notre Dame faithful are known for their tradition, their global reach, and their unwavering support for the Fighting Irish.
